Gout is defined as unpleasant joint swelling. It occurs most often in the very first metatarsophalangeal joints. This is brought on by rainfall of monosodium-urate crystals within a joint space. Gout is normally diagnosed by the American College of Rheumatology using medical criteria. Monosodium urate crystals found in the synovial fluid may validate medical diagnosis.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(corticosteroids or colchicine) might be used to deal with severe gout. Patients ought to avoid certain purine-rich foods, such as organ meats and shellfish, and limit their intake of alcohol (especially beer) or drinks sweetened with high fructose corn syrup to lower the chance of reoccurring flare-ups. Motivation ought to be offered to vegetables and low-fat, or nonfat dairy items. Loop and thiazide diuretics can raise uric acids levels. Losartan, an angiotensin receptor blocking drug, increases urinary excretion. Gout flares can be prevented by minimizing uric acid levels. First-line medication for the avoidance of reoccurring, extreme gout attacks is Allopurinol or Febuxostat. Colchicine and/or Probenecid need to be used for patients who are unable to endure first-line drugs. To prevent flare-ups, patients who are taking urate-lowering medication ought to also be getting n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(colchicine), low-dose corticosteroids, and colchicine. Clients with a history or tophi ought to continue treatment for at least three months after their uric acid levels drop listed below the target goal.

For clients with diabetes mellitus, corticosteroids can be used as a short-term alternative to NSAIDs and colchicine. Nevertheless, it is important to keep track of for hyperglycemia. In the case of gout that is restricted to one joint, intra-articular corticosteroids may be chosen to systemic corticosteroids due to their lower adverse results profile.23 Rebound flares can take place after stopping corticosteroid treatment for acute gout. After fixing signs, preventive treatment is advised. A tapered dose of corticosteroids ought to be initiated over 10-14 days to lower the chance of a rebound flare.

International guidelines recommend xanthine oxide inhibitors as the first-line treatment, and uricosurics representatives as the second-line. Allopurinol, probenecid and probenecid are the most efficient xanthine oxide inhibitors and uricosuric representatives. The table below lists possible treatment alternatives. Table 4 lists possible treatment choices. A higher percentage of patients reach the target uric acid levels of 6 mg/dL using febuxostat, which is likewise a xanthine oxide inhibitor, than with allopurinol (22% vs 48%). For treatment-refractory hyperuricemia, Febuxostat might be an alternative. If this does not work, you can combine therapy with a mix of a xanthine oxide inhibitor and lesinurad (a selective inhibitor the URAT1 transporter). Routine lab screening is needed to ensure treatment success. If treatment fails, treatment needs to be changed (C). Traditional imaging has actually not been used in primary medical diagnosis of gout. Gout does not trigger radiologically visible bone modifications, and only then can it progress to a later phase (e9). To keep track of the development of treatment, it may be possible to identify tophi in soft tissues earlier. As a noninvasive choice, ultrasound evaluation might be used. Sonography reveals synovialitis, with a noticeably greater vascularization and double shape sign. (e10, 15). Dual-energy CT (DECT), which can detect percentages of uric acids crystals, should be utilized just if differential diagnoses are not clear. It includes radiation direct exposure and has low general sensitivity (15 ). gout treatment causes.

The FDA authorized the 2009 use of febuxostat as a brand-new xanthine oxidase inhibitor for the treatment of hyperuricemia. The serum uric acids have actually reduced in a dose-dependent manner (everyday dosages of 80mg and 120mg). Clients with mild to moderate kidney disability or gout have reported its efficiency. It can cause liver function irregularities and regular tracking of bloodwork is recommended. There are comparable interactions to allopurinol with azathioprine 6MP and theophylline.

Pegloticase. Pegloticase (Krystexxa), an intravenous urinary uricase, was authorized by FDA in 2010. The system of action is the conversion of uric acid into allantoin. It is shown to deal with refractory and serious gout. It is normally administered by a doctor who focuses on gout. The dosages are given when every 2 weeks and cost more than $5,000 each.
Gout Treatment Causes FAQ:
What is the main treatment for gout?
NSAIDs.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) are usually recommended as the first treatment for gout. They work by reducing pain and inflammation during an attack. NSAIDs used to treat gout include naproxen, diclofenac and etoricoxib.May 11, 2022
What foods get rid of gout?
The most popular remedy for gout is tart cherry juice, which may help to decrease uric acid levels and ease gout symptoms. 3 Foods that are high in vitamin C can also lower the risk of a gout flare-up. Vitamin C-rich foods include oranges, grapefruit, strawberries, tomatoes, spinach, and kale.Dec 16, 2021
What is the best thing to drink if you have gout?
Drink plenty of water, milk and tart cherry juice. Drinking coffee seems to help as well. Be sure to talk with your doctor before making any dietary changes.Jan 2, 2020
